Somerset farmer, 70, injured after being struck by a rock thrown by dog walker

Date of alert:

Wednesday, 11 May 2022

Crime Ref:

Force:

Avon & Somerset Constabulary

A SOMERSET farmer has been hospitalised after he was struck with a rock while working in a field.

Christopher Pine, 70, was ploughing a field in Creech St Michael, near Taunton, when he was attacked by a dog walker.

“Without any provocation or anything else, this walker threw dirt at him as he was driving past, so he stopped to ask ‘what’s the problem’ to find out why he’d done this,” said his wife, jane Pine.

“He was then told ‘don’t plough the footpath’, which of course he wasn’t – he does everything 100 per cent correctly. We rent the field so in a sense you’re even more careful with what you do.”

After a brief exchange in which Mr Pine informed the man of his right to work the field, the dog walker picked up a rock and and threw it at the farmer’s head before running off.

Mr Pine suffered cuts on the side of his head, which resulted in heavy bleeding.
